Well, a Logitech UE SmartRadio will do much of what a Touch does so long
as you're not interested in an external DAC.  Just plug a stereo patch
cord between the SmartRadio headphone output and a high-level input on
your amplifier/receiver.  You'll get basically the same local music
library and internet radio functionality as with a Touch.  Same
iOS/Android controller apps as well.  Limited to 24/48 if that matters.

A cheaper and somewhat DIY alternative is a Raspberry Pi running
SqueezePlug/Squeezelite.  It has an analog audio output or you can plug
in a cheap external USB DAC.
